Gu Mian and the other two did not have a fixed place to live.

After leaving the Heartbeat Hide-and-Seek instance, the weather became even more severe.

The continuous snowstorm has stopped, but the temperature shows no signs of rising.

The snow a few days ago turned this place into a white expanse, with snow piled up on the ground, tree branches, and rooftops.

The car windows were frozen solid, making it difficult to see anything outside.

It's not suitable to stay huddled in the hearse under such harsh weather conditions, unless you want to die right there in this broken-down vehicle.

So Gu Mian found a dilapidated house.

It was less of a search and more of a forced entry.

This is a dilapidated neighborhood in a remote location, with very few people living there.

Gu Mian randomly picked a building that looked deserted and went upstairs with the fat locksmith.

The handrails on the stairs were covered in cobwebs, and it looked like they hadn't been cleaned in a long time.

The fat man, wrapped in a cotton-padded coat, trembled as he fiddled with the door lock and asked, "Doctor, aren't we breaking the law?"

Gu Mian nodded: "If you don't break the law, you'll freeze to death outside."

The fat man shuddered: "Luckily, I used to do lock picking..."

Gu Mian asked curiously, "Have you ever been a thief?"

"Pah!" the fat man quickly denied. "What thief? I've worked as a locksmith!"

It has to be said that fat people have dabbled in quite a few industries.

In no time at all, the fat man had managed to pick the lock.

The dilapidated building had only five floors, and the fat man chose the third floor, saying that he wouldn't get cold on the middle floors.

At this moment, Chu Changge also came up from below with Xiao Hong. The two, one human and one ghost, had been packing things down below, and now they had brought up a batch of items.

Chu Changge, empty-handed, piled all the bedding and miscellaneous items on Xiao Hong and watched from the side.

Gu Mian was quite worried that Xiao Hong would be crushed to death.

The fat man had already entered the house.

Because the house had been unoccupied for a long time, all the blankets, mattresses, and sofa cushions that were prone to mold were taken away.

However, the furniture was complete, and there was even a worn-out little air conditioner hanging on the wall, although it had turned yellow.

There is a brand new card slot on the wall to the right of the entrance.

“This should be a card slot for the new power-on card that the game added specifically,” Gu Mian said, looking at the card slot and taking a card out of her pocket. “Now every house should have this card slot.”

He inserted the card as he spoke.

There is currently a global power outage, and the only way to obtain electricity is by purchasing a power card from a supermarket and inserting it into the card slot.

I have to say the electricity cards in the supermarket are really not cheap. They just give you a card and the cashier will charge you the amount of electricity you need to buy.

One kilowatt-hour of electricity costs three game coins.

In the current environment, air conditioning is essential, but one kilowatt-hour of electricity can only power an air conditioner for one hour. In such cold conditions, even without using any other appliances and only running the air conditioner for twelve hours a day, it would still cost thirty-six game coins.

While doing the calculations, Gu Mian looked at the fat man next to her: "I remember you only got twenty game coins when you settled down in the last dungeon, right?"

The fat man lowered his head in shame again.

That's right.

The dungeon was rated 25 points, and I only got 20 game coins, nothing else.

Because he was almost always hiding in the instance.

Speaking of this...

Gu Mian looked at Chu Changge beside her: "How did you know I would pass by the place where Fatty was hiding in the last instance?"

He did indeed go through that process before he was able to reunite with the fat man.

Chu Changge pushed up his glasses: "You also know that there's a connecting clue in that hide-and-seek instance. As long as you follow that clue, you'll eventually discover the ghost's conspiracy."

"The clues are actually interconnected. For example, you find clue number 1 at location A, which points to location B. You go to location B and find clue number 2, which leads you to the final location C, where the final answer is hidden."

"I hid the fat guy on the only way from B to C. To be on the safe side, I specifically hid him near the last clue, so even if you take a detour, the fat guy will see you as long as you reach the end."

It turns out that Chu Changge had already discovered the entire clue in the hide-and-seek instance.

Gu Mian asked, "Since you know that C is the end point, it means you must have been to location C. Otherwise, it's impossible to determine whether C is a link in the chain of clues or the end point."

Chu Changge acquiesced.

In other words, Chu Changge discovered the ghost's conspiracy from the very beginning, but he did not use the phone that could call all players to inform them of this.

This directly led to unsuspecting hunters wanting to tear the ghost apart, allowing the ghost to roam freely in the dungeon after gaining the hunter's identity, resulting in the tragic deaths of many players.

Of course, the ghost was quite arrogant at first, but it was defeated after meeting Gu Mian.

Chu Changge continued, "Because if all players know about the ghost's conspiracy, no player will actively try to catch the ghost, and the ghost will not be able to become a hunter."

The fat man hesitated before speaking, "In the hide-and-seek instance, isn't it good that the ghosts don't become the hunters? Everyone will be safe."

“No, we need to get close to the ghost to gather information about the instance,” Chu Changge shook his head. “If the ghost continues to possess the identity of a survivor, then Gu Mian must not approach the ghost under any circumstances; we all know that the first hunter to capture the ghost will switch identities with the ghost, and if Gu Mian goes to find the ghost while still holding the identity of a hunter, her life cannot be guaranteed.”

The fat man understood.

Although Gu Mian is almost invincible against dungeon creatures, the hide-and-seek dungeon has survivor and hunter factions. If Gu Mian and the ghost switch identities, and the hunters have absolute suppression over the survivors, who knows what kind of accident will happen.

"The best-case scenario is that Gu Mian and Gui are on the same side. I've considered that it's safer for them to be on the same side as the Hunters, so I haven't informed the other players about this."

Therefore, Chu Changge deliberately concealed important clues, prompting the ghost to transform from a survivor to a hunter.

As for the hunter, Gui did not manage to do anything to Gu Mian, but he did provide the number "seven". Although the number was destroyed after it was spoken, it also signifies the importance of this clue.

The fat man laughed awkwardly: "I didn't expect that Brother Chu, who looks so fair and clean, would be black inside..."

Gu Mian stroked her chin beside her: "So, in future dungeons, similar situations will occur again, right? I have to trick other players to get the clues I want."

Chu Changge nodded: "Not all dungeons will experience this situation, but there is a chance that it will happen again; and you should understand that the dungeons you participate in are one-time events, and once you give up the clues, you will never have the chance to return to the previous dungeon."
